Nice shooting Bud! I went through all of my arrows and had two or three that shot better with the cock feather in. I marked them to help me remember to shoot them that way.

Good point Bona. I now shoot cock feather in on my Hill style bows due to low brace. My recurves, with 8" +/- brace, I don't see much, if any, difference.
